Abstract

The utility model discloses a protection circuit for an open circuit. The protection circuit for the open circuit comprises at least two load branch circuits of a constant-current drive circuit, and at least one open circuit protecting module, wherein the two connecting ends of the open circuit protecting module are connected with two ends with the same polarity of one pair of load branch circuits in at least two load branch circuits, and the other two ends with the same polarity of the pair of load branch circuits are equipotential; the open circuit protecting module detects the difference value of voltage between two ends connected with the open circuit protecting module, when the voltage difference value smaller than a pre-set difference value threshold is judged, the two ends are enabled to be under an off-state; and when the voltage difference value is not less than the pre-set difference value threshold is judged, the two ends are enabled to be under a short circuit state. The protection circuit for the open circuit achieves low cost, and has a wider scope of application.

Background
The Light Emitting Diode (LED) constant current driving circuit with multi-path output generally comprises a constant current driving main circuit and at least two load branches, wherein each load branch is connected with at least one LED load in series. Because the load is a plurality of branches, in the constant current driving circuit, load current balance on the plurality of load branches needs to be realized, that is, the total current output by the constant current driving main circuit is distributed to each path of LED load according to the load requirement.
In practical application, different constant current driving main circuit implementation schemes generally exist for realizing load current balance on a load branch of an LED constant current driving circuit. In the LED constant current driving circuit shown in fig. 1, the dc blocking capacitor C1 connected in series to the secondary loop of the transformer T1 is used to achieve load current balance between the two load branches a1 and a 2; in the LED constant current driving circuit shown in fig. 2, a current sharing transformer T2 is used to achieve load current balancing on two load branches a1 and a 2; in the LED constant current driving circuit shown in fig. 3, load current balance between the two load branches a1 and a2 is achieved by the primary side series connection of the main transformers T3 and T4.
The three load current balancing schemes have a common characteristic: in two load branches of the LED constant current driving circuit, once an LED load on a certain load branch is opened, the load branch has an abnormal overvoltage phenomenon. If it is ensured that the LED load on a certain load branch is open-circuited, the LED loads on other load branches can still work normally, and an open-circuit protection circuit needs to be additionally added to the load branch.
A conventional open circuit protection circuit in the prior art is shown in fig. 4, and is respectively disposed on each load branch of the LED constant current driving circuit (only two load branches are shown in fig. 4), and each open circuit protection circuit respectively includes a thyristor (thyristor SCR shown in the figure) and two resistors (first resistor R1 and second resistor R2 shown in the figure). When overvoltage occurs to a certain load branch, the thyristor corresponding to the load branch is triggered to be conducted, and the load branch is short-circuited, so that normal work of the LED load on other load branches is guaranteed.
However, in the open-circuit protection circuit implemented by the way that the load branch is short-circuited by the thyristor, once an overvoltage phenomenon occurs, the impact current flowing through the thyristor is very large, so that a large-current thyristor needs to be selected in practical application, and the implementation cost of the open-circuit protection circuit is too high; moreover, if the main circuit of the LED constant current driving circuit adopts a BOOST topology structure, since the BOOST type circuits cannot directly perform load branch short circuit connection, the open circuit protection circuit cannot be applied to the LED constant current driving circuit, and the application range is small.

Detailed Description
Hereinafter, the implementation of the open circuit protection circuit according to the embodiment of the present invention will be described in detail with reference to the accompanying drawings.
The embodiment of the utility model provides an open circuit protection circuit includes: at least two load branches of constant current drive circuit and at least one open circuit protection module, wherein:
two connecting ends of one open-circuit protection module are connected with two ends of a pair of load branches in the at least two load branches, which have the same polarity, and the other two ends of the pair of load branches, which have the same polarity, are equipotential;
the open circuit protection module detects a voltage difference value between two ends connected with the open circuit protection module, and when the voltage difference value is judged to be smaller than a preset difference threshold value, the two ends are in an open circuit state; and when the voltage difference is judged to be not less than the preset difference threshold value, the two ends are in a short-circuit state.
The specific realization principle is as follows:
because the two ends with the same polarity of the two load branches are connected with the open-circuit protection module, the other two ends with the same polarity are equipotential, when the voltage difference value between the two ends with the same polarity is not less than the preset difference threshold value, the open-circuit overvoltage phenomenon of one load branch is shown, so that the open-circuit protection module shorts the two ends connected with the open-circuit protection module, the output of the open-circuit overvoltage load branch is clamped at the normal output of the other load branch, and the normally output load branch continues to keep the normal working state; therefore, the open-circuit protection is realized for the load branch circuit with the open-circuit overvoltage phenomenon, and the normal work of other load branch circuits is also kept.
In practical application, when the constant current driving circuit has a plurality of load branches, in order to realize open circuit protection for each load branch, each two adjacent load branches may be respectively used as the pair of load branches and correspond to one open circuit protection module; alternatively, each two load branches of the at least two load branches may be respectively used as the pair of load branches, and correspond to one open-circuit protection module. For example, the constant current driving circuit sequentially includes a load branch 1, a load branch 2, and a load branch 3, and then: taking the load branch 1 and the load branch 2 as a pair of load branches, and taking the load branch 2 and the load branch 3 as a pair of load branches; alternatively, it is also possible: the load branch 1 and the load branch 2 are regarded as a pair of load branches, the load branch 2 and the load branch 3 are regarded as a pair of load branches, and the load branch 1 and the load branch 3 are regarded as a pair of load branches.
The embodiment of the present invention provides an open circuit protection circuit, which can be applied not only to the LED constant current driving circuit shown in fig. 1 to fig. 3, but also to other LED constant current driving circuits, such as an LED constant current driving circuit based on a BOOST topology structure; moreover, this open circuit protection circuit can also be applicable to other constant current drive circuit that contains two at least load branch roads, for example, the constant current drive circuit that the main circuit topology structure of the LED constant current drive circuit shown in fig. 1-3 constitutes just can regard as the constant current drive circuit of other loads, at this moment, the utility model discloses an open circuit protection circuit still can regard as the open circuit protection circuit that corresponds constant current drive circuit, carry out the open circuit protection of each load branch road of constant current drive circuit.
In the open-circuit protection circuit shown in fig. 5, because an open-circuit protection module is connected between two ends of two load branches with the same polarity, and the other two ends with the same polarity are equipotential, the open-circuit protection module performs open-circuit protection of the two load branches by detecting whether the voltage difference between the two ends connected with the open-circuit protection module is smaller than the difference threshold, so that a large-current thyristor does not need to be selected as in the prior art, and the implementation cost of the open-circuit protection circuit is reduced; in addition, the short-circuit output of the load branch is not carried out, so that the open-circuit protection circuit can also be suitable for a constant-current driving circuit based on a BOOST topological structure, and the application range is wider.
The open circuit protection module may be implemented by different structures, listed below respectively:
the open circuit protection module can be realized by a pressure-sensitive device, such as a pressure-sensitive resistor and the like. For example, as shown in fig. 5, the two ends of the voltage-sensitive device are connected to the positive terminal of the first load branch a1 and the positive terminal of the second load branch a2 as the two connection terminals of the open-circuit protection module.
As shown in fig. 5, the negative terminal of the first load branch a1 is directly connected to the negative terminal of the second load branch a2, so as to ensure that the negative terminals of the two load branches are at the same potential. Or, in practical applications, the negative terminals of the two load branches may also be equipotential by grounding or a common level, which is not described herein.
Specifically, as shown in fig. 6, the voltage-sensitive device may also be a voltage regulator tube, and at this time, the open-circuit protection module may include: a first and a second voltage regulator ZD1 and ZD 2; the first voltage-stabilizing tube and the second voltage-stabilizing tube are voltage-stabilizing tubes with short circuit failure modes when bearing over-power; the cathode of the first voltage-stabilizing tube ZD1 is connected with the cathode of the second voltage-stabilizing tube ZD2, the anode of the first voltage-stabilizing tube ZD1 is used as the first connection end of the open-circuit protection module and is connected with the positive end of the first load branch A1, and the anode of the second voltage-stabilizing tube ZD2 is used as the second connection end of the open-circuit protection module and is connected with the positive end of the second load branch A2.
As shown in fig. 6, the negative terminal of the first load branch a1 and the negative terminal of the second load branch a2 are directly connected to ensure that the negative terminals of the two load branches are at the same potential. Or, in practical applications, the negative terminals of the two load branches may also be equipotential by grounding or a common level, which is not described herein.
Alternatively, as shown in fig. 7, the open circuit protection module may include a detection control unit and a processing unit, wherein,
the detection control unit is used for detecting a voltage difference value between two ends connected with the open-circuit protection module, judging the magnitude relation between the voltage difference value and a preset difference value threshold value, and controlling the two ends connected with the open-circuit protection module to be correspondingly short-circuited or switched off according to a judgment result;
specifically, the detection control unit is configured to control the processing unit to make the two ends in an open circuit state when the voltage difference is smaller than a preset difference threshold; and when the voltage difference is judged to be not less than the preset difference threshold value, the processing unit is controlled to enable the two ends to be in a short-circuit state.
And the processing unit is used for enabling the two ends connected with the open-circuit protection module to be in an open-circuit state or enabling the two ends connected with the open-circuit protection module to be in a short-circuit state under the control of the detection control unit.
The processing unit may be a bidirectional switch device, so as to turn off or short circuit two ends connected to the open-circuit protection module. The bidirectional switching device may be: a triac, etc.
Specifically, as shown in fig. 8, the negative terminal of the first load branch a1 is directly connected to the negative terminal of the second load branch a 2; the detection control unit includes: a third regulator ZD3, a fourth regulator ZD4, a third resistor R3 and a second capacitor C2; and the processing unit includes: a triac Q1. As shown in fig. 8, in which,
a T2 end of the bidirectional thyristor Q1 is used as a first connection end of the open-circuit protection module (detection control unit) and connected with the positive end of the first load branch a1, and a T1 end is used as a second connection end of the open-circuit protection module (detection control unit) and connected with the positive end of the second load branch a 2;
the cathode of the third voltage-stabilizing tube ZD3 is connected with the cathode of the fourth voltage-stabilizing tube ZD4, the anode of the third voltage-stabilizing tube ZD3 is connected with the T2 end of the bidirectional thyristor Q1, and the anode of the fourth voltage-stabilizing tube ZD4 is connected with the G end of the bidirectional thyristor Q1;
the third resistor R3 and the second capacitor C2 are connected in parallel to the T1 terminal and the G terminal of the triac Q1.
As shown in fig. 9-11, the embodiment of the present invention shown in fig. 7 is provided to implement a schematic structure of a circuit in which the open-circuit protection circuit is applied to two LED constant current driving circuits shown in fig. 1-3. As shown in fig. 9, in the LED constant current driving circuit, the dc blocking capacitor C1 connected in series to the secondary side loop of the transformer T1 realizes current balancing of the two load branches. As shown in fig. 10, in the LED constant current driving circuit, current balancing of two load branches is achieved through a current sharing transformer T2. As shown in fig. 11, in the LED constant current driving circuit, current balancing of two load branches is achieved through main transformers T3 and T4 in which primary windings are connected in series.
In addition, because in the utility model discloses in the open circuit protection circuit, need not carry out short-circuit treatment to the load branch road of constant current drive circuit, consequently, also can be applicable to the open circuit protection among the constant current drive circuit based on BOOST topological structure. As shown in fig. 12, a schematic structural diagram of an implementation of the open-circuit protection circuit applied to the LED constant current driving circuit based on the BOOST topology structure is given. As shown in fig. 12: the open circuit protection module is realized by a first voltage regulator tube ZD1 and a second voltage regulator tube ZD 2. The specific circuit structure is as follows:
the positive end of an input voltage Vin of the LED constant-current driving circuit is connected with the drain electrode of the switching tube Q2 through the inductor L, and the negative end of the input voltage Vin of the LED constant-current driving circuit is connected with the source electrode of the switching tube Q2; the dotted terminal of the first winding of the current sharing transformer T5 is connected with the drain of the switch tube Q2, and the non-dotted terminal is connected with the positive terminal of the first load branch A1 through a first diode D1; the non-dotted terminal of the second winding is connected with the drain of the switching tube Q2, and the dotted terminal is connected with the positive terminal of the second load branch a2 through a second diode D2; the source of the switching tube Q2 is grounded, and is connected to the negative terminal of the first load branch a1 and the negative terminal of the second load branch a2, respectively;
the first filter capacitor C3 is connected in series with the cathode of the first diode D1 and the source of the switching tube Q2; the second filter capacitor C4 is connected in series to the cathode of the second diode D2 and the source of the switching tube Q2.
Through the circuit structure, open-circuit protection of each load branch of the LED constant-current driving circuit based on the BOOST topological structure is realized.
